如何自制云盘服务器链接,如何自制云盘服务器,打造个人专属云端存储空间
- 综合资讯
- 2024-12-20 02:03:20
- 2

自制云盘服务器,打造个人云端存储空间,只需简单几步:选择合适的硬件,安装操作系统和云存储软件,配置网络服务,即可创建专属云盘。通过链接分享,实现文件远程访问和管理。...
自制云盘服务器,打造个人云端存储空间,只需简单几步:选择合适的硬件,安装操作系统和云存储软件,配置网络服务,即可创建专属云盘。通过链接分享,实现文件远程访问和管理。
随着互联网的快速发展,云盘已成为人们日常生活中不可或缺的一部分,云盘不仅可以方便地存储文件,还能实现文件的随时随地访问和分享,市面上的云盘服务往往存在隐私泄露、存储空间有限等问题,就教大家如何自制云盘服务器,打造个人专属云端存储空间。
自制云盘服务器所需条件
1、一台电脑(推荐配置:CPU:i5以上,内存:8GB以上,硬盘:500GB以上)
2、操作系统:Windows、Linux或MacOS
3、硬盘空间:根据需求自行配置,建议至少1TB以上
4、服务器软件:如Nextcloud、ownCloud等
5、网络环境:稳定宽带接入
自制云盘服务器步骤
1、安装操作系统
在电脑上安装一台虚拟机,选择Windows、Linux或MacOS作为操作系统,这里以Windows为例,下载并安装VMware Workstation或VirtualBox等虚拟机软件。
2、配置虚拟机
(1)创建虚拟机:在虚拟机软件中创建一台虚拟机,分配CPU、内存和硬盘空间。
(2)安装操作系统:将操作系统安装到虚拟机中,按照提示完成安装。
3、安装服务器软件
(1)下载Nextcloud:访问Nextcloud官网(https://nextcloud.com/),下载Nextcloud服务器软件。
(2)安装Nextcloud:在虚拟机中打开命令行,进入Nextcloud安装目录,执行以下命令:
sudo ./occ install:app files
等待安装完成,即可在浏览器中访问Nextcloud服务器。
4、配置云盘服务器
(1)设置域名:为了方便访问,建议为虚拟机设置一个域名,在DNS服务商处购买域名,并将域名解析到虚拟机的公网IP地址。
(2)安装Apache模块:Nextcloud依赖于Apache模块,需要安装mod_rewrite模块。
sudo apt-get install libapache2-mod-rewrite
(3)配置SSL证书:为了提高安全性,建议为Nextcloud服务器配置SSL证书,可以使用Let's Encrypt免费证书。
sudo apt-get install certbot python3-certbot-apache sudo certbot --apache
(4)配置文件存储路径:在Nextcloud的配置文件中,设置文件存储路径,找到配置文件:
sudo nano /etc/nextcloud/config.php
在文件中添加以下代码:
'files' => [ 'store' => 'local', 'path' => '/path/to/your/cloud/directory', ],
将/path/to/your/cloud/directory
替换为你的云盘存储路径。
5、测试云盘服务器
(1)访问Nextcloud:在浏览器中输入域名或IP地址,即可访问Nextcloud云盘服务器。
(2)注册账户:在Nextcloud服务器中注册账户,即可开始使用云盘服务。
(3)上传和下载文件:在Nextcloud界面,可以上传、下载、分享和管理文件。
注意事项
1、定期备份:为了防止数据丢失,建议定期备份云盘服务器中的数据。
2、优化性能:根据实际需求,可以调整虚拟机的配置,提高云盘服务器的性能。
3、安全防护:加强云盘服务器的安全防护,防止恶意攻击和数据泄露。
通过以上步骤,您就可以成功自制云盘服务器,打造个人专属云端存储空间,从此,您将告别存储空间不足、文件丢失的烦恼,尽情享受云盘带来的便捷。
本文链接:https://www.zhitaoyun.cn/1673270.html
发表评论